im钱包与TP钱包详解:从Solidity到NFT与全球化发展

简介:im钱包(通常指imToken)和TP钱包(TokenPocket)是两款主流的去中心化数字资产钱包。二者均为非托管钱包,用户掌控私钥,提供多链资产管理、DApp浏览器、签名与交易广播等功能。下面从技术与产业多个维度展开解析。

1. 基本功能与差异

- im钱包:以以太坊生态起家,支持ERC20/ERC721/ERC1155等,界面偏简洁,注重代币资产展示与DApp接入。

- TP钱包:强调多链、多节点与多资产支持,DApp生态接入广泛,常用于跨链和手机端互动。二者在安全理念相近,但在链支持深度、社区与插件生态上各有侧重。

2. Solidity角度

钱包主要作用是对智能合约交易进行签名与发送。开发者在写Solidity合约时,应考虑钱包交互的易用性:明确事件、返回值与错误信息;采用EIP-712结构化数据签名以提升签名可读性;对链上函数的权限、重入与边界条件做充分检查。钱包通过RPC与节点交互,或通过WalletConnect / injected web3与前端交互,必须正确处理nonce、gas估算与重放保护。

3. 预挖币(预挖代币)问题

预挖代币指项目在发行前已由团队或基金会持有一定比例,这对钱包用户意味着风险与合规考量。钱包需提供代币来源信息展示、代币合约验证与来源提醒。用户应在授权前审查合约地址、发行比例、锁仓与时间表,并对大额转账或流动性池授权保持谨慎,必要时通过拒绝或分段授权降低风险。

4. 个性化支付设置

现代钱包支持自定义Gas、选择支付代币、设置交易加速与取消、批量转账、定时任务与多签功能。高级功能还包括Meta-transaction(免gas体验),Paymaster机制,以及按策略自动选择最优链路与费用代币。为了更好地个性化,钱包应提供策略模板、白名单与交易提醒,并支持硬件钱包与生物识别等二次验证。

5. 全球化与智能化发展

未来钱包朝向全球化、本地化与智能化发展:支持多语言、合规弹性(如不同司法区KYC/AML配置)、跨链互操作与流动性路由;引入AI辅助风控、钓鱼识别与交易风险评分;智能化Gas策略与费用优化,以及与法币通道的无缝衔接,提升新用户入门体验。

6. NFT市场中的钱包角色

钱包是NFT持有、展示与交易的入口。要支持完善的NFT metadata解析、IPFS/Arweave链接校验、懒铸造(lazy minting)与版税处理。钱包应提醒用户在授权市场合约前查看版税与销售条款,并在签名时清晰展示条目,避免误签导致NFT被转移或授权滥用。

7. 专家视角与建议

- 用户层面:优先使用信誉良好、开源或接受审计的钱包,开启多重备份并考虑硬件钱包;限制代币授权额度,定期撤销不必要的Allowance。

- 开发者层面:遵循EIP标准(如EIP-712、ERC-20、ERC-721、ERC-1155),提供清晰的事件日志与错误反馈,考虑Gas友好性与可升级机制。

- 项目方:在代币发行与预挖安排上提高透明度,发布锁仓证明与审计,避免短期内大量抛售。

- 行业角度:推动更友好的UX(如账号抽象、社交恢复),同时强化合规与隐私保护的平衡。

结语:im钱包和TP钱包作为入口层工具,在用户资产管理、DApp交互与NFT市场中扮演关键角色。随着多链、AI与合规发展,钱包将在安全性、可用性与全球化服务上持续演进。理解Solidity交互、预挖风险与个性化支付能力,是用户与开发者的共同必修课。

作者:凌云发布时间:2025-12-15 01:06:32

评论

Crypto小白

写得很全面,尤其是关于预挖币的风险提示,受教了。

AlexW

喜欢Solidity与钱包交互那部分,EIP-712那项应该普及。

链上观察者

关于NFT的懒铸造和授权提醒非常重要,建议钱包增加更醒目的签名展示。

MayaChen

对个性化支付和全球化的展望很有洞察,期待更多实践案例。

相关阅读
<area lang="7fh"></area><address id="woa"></address><abbr dir="mhh"></abbr><tt draggable="xv3"></tt>